This category features a collection of terms used to express appreciation and gratitude in different languages across the globe.
The connection is linguistic and thematic; each clue serves as the direct translation of the phrase 'Thank you' in Hawaiian, German, Japanese, French, and Spanish respectively.
| Word | Explanation |
|---|---|
| Mahalo | Mahalo: The traditional Hawaiian expression used to convey gratitude, admiration, or praise. |
| Danke | Danke: The standard German word for 'thank you,' rooted in the concept of thought and memory. |
| Arigato | Arigato: A common Japanese expression of thanks, originating from the word 'arigatai' meaning 'to be grateful.' |
| Merci | Merci: The French word for 'thank you,' derived from the Latin 'mercedem' meaning reward or wages. |
| Gracias | Gracias: The Spanish plural noun used to give thanks, originating from the Latin word 'gratia.' |
